P retty tag made to match a 30th anniversary box from Stampin' Up!
Project Recipe
Cut cardstock pieces to the following sizes using a Stampin' Trimmer:
- 2" x 4-1/4" from Whisper White Cardstock
- 2" x 4-3/8" from Calypso Coral Cardstock
- 2" x 4-1/2" from Pear Pizzazz Cardstock
- 2" x 4" from Whisper White Cardstock
- 2" x 4-1/2" from Old Olive Cardstock
As you are ready to stamp using the Bouquet Blooms Set, place the cardstock on the Stampin' Pierce Mat. Using the mat will help you get a cleaner image each time you stamp.
Mount the large grouping of flowers and leaves image from the Bouquet Blooms Set on Block H. Ink it up with the Memento Pad. Stamp it in the center of the 2" x 4" rectangle of white cardstock. Set aside to let it dry for a few minutes.
Unlock the Scalloped Tag Topper Punch. Slide one end of the 2" x 4-1/4" Whisper White Cardstock into the punch as far as it will go. Punch. Leave the punch unlocked.
Slide one end of the Calypso Coral Cardstock into the punch as far as it will go. Punch. Leave the punch unlocked.
Slide one end of the Pear Pizzazz Cardstock into the punch as far as it will go. Punch.
Mount the "thanks" or "friend" sentiment from the Bouquet Blooms Set on Block G. Ink it up with the Night of Navy Ink Pad. Stamp it in the center of the white tag about 1-1/2" down from the ribbon hole in the top of the tag. WITHOUT re-inking, stamp the sentiment again just below the previously stamped image so it overlaps a tiny bit. WITHOUT re-inking, stamp the sentiment again just above the first stamped sentiment so it overlaps a tiny bit.
Adhere the white tag to the Calypso Coral tag and then to the Pear Pizzazz tag so they are at slight angles to each other.
Pick out the large, open, grouping of flowers and leaves framelit from the Gatefold Blossoms Framelits. Place the stamped grouping of flowers and leaves image on the Cutting Pad on top of the Magnetic Platform on the Big Shot. Place the grouping of flowers and leaves framelit on top so it is centered over the stamped image. Place another Cutting Pad on top and run through the Big Shot.
Use Paper Snips to cut away the leaves stamped on the right side of the flowers and leave bunch.
Place the stamped and cut out grouping of flowers image on top of some paper on your work surface (Grid Paper works great). You need to make sure that you protect your work surface with paper as the Stampin' Blends Markers do bleed through.
Start coloring with the Stampin' Blends Markers. The markers have a brush tip for coloring in larger areas and a fine tip for coloring in smaller areas. Use the light colors first and add highlights with the darker colors. If needed to blend the colors, go over things again with the lighter colors. Work on one area at a time so the inks will be wet and will blend easier.
Use the Dark Pineapple Punch Marker to color in the center of the rose flower just left of center.
Use the Dark and Light Calypso Coral Markers to color in and blend the rest of the rose flower just left of center.
Use the Dark Poppy Parade Marker to color in the three small flowers on the left.
Use the Dark and Light Bermuda Bay Markers to color in the two flowers just to the right of center.
Use the Light Night of Navy Marker to color in the centers of the two solid black flowers (one on the right and one between the rose and three small flowers on the left).
Adhere the colored and cut out grouping of flowers image to the bottom of the white tag at a slight angle. The edges will hang over the edges of the tag on the right and left sides a bit.
Pick out the right angle edge framelit with leaves on the end and leaves in the squared off tab from the Gatefold Blossoms Framelits. Place the piece of Old Olive Cardstock on the Cutting Pad on top of the Platform on the Big Shot. Place the right angle edge framelit on top of it so you'll cut out the leaves. Place another Cutting Pad on top and run through the Big Shot.
Use Paper Snips to cut the leaves from any remaining cardstock.
Adhere the leaves to the tag so they tuck under the flower grouping image.
Carefully peel up 3 small rhinestones from a sheet of Clear Rhinestone Basic Jewels making sure that you get the adhesive backings as well. Adhere them to the centers of the three small Poppy Parade flowers on the left side of the tag.
Carefully peel up a medium gem from a sheet of Clear Faceted Gems making sure that you get the adhesive backing as well. Adhere it to the center of the solid black and blue flower on the right side of the tag.
Cut a length of Night of Navy Medium Baker's Twine. Fold it in half. Stick the folded end through the ribbon hole in the tag from the front. Pull the loop up a bit. Thread the loose ends of the twine through the loop and pull tight. Use the loose ends of the twine to tie the tag to the Whisper White 3/8" Classic Weave Ribbon wrapped around the box. Trim the ends.
